Wyfold is a quintessentially English hamlet surrounded by gently rolling hills, open farmland, and ancient woodlands. Though delightfully secluded, it is within easy driving distance of Henley-on-Thames, with its boutique shops, cafés, restaurants and the world-renowned Henley Royal Regatta. For commuters, Reading station offers direct services to London Paddington in under half an hour, and the nearby A4074 provides straightforward access to both Oxford and the M4 motorway.
